Output f93139da2a44bb664364d5fdc615c4bb8e26d27b74d4bb2ef84d37502e22b3ac:18

value
10973245
script pubkey
OP_0 OP_PUSHBYTES_20 96d3865632f6e01d64d8ecedc27a277f5423a262
address
bc1qjmfcv43j7msp6excankuy7380a2z8gnzcxr9st
transaction
f93139da2a44bb664364d5fdc615c4bb8e26d27b74d4bb2ef84d37502e22b3ac
confirmations
202536
spent
true